Part 2
And here's the little project that's taken up vast chunks of my weekend.
Those of you who have seen me posting around the web over the years will have realised that when I get my head into a project, I often get carried away. This weekend was no different.
I've decided that I like the Pit Fighter concept as put forward in part 1 of two articles in Fanatic Mag giving the rules for this new skirmish game.
I havent played it yet, but I did realise that I had the parts needed to make a relatively simple little(?) "pit". So I've spent every spare second I have been able to muster cutting balsa, plastic, card & hardboard to make one before even testing the rules!
Its not the prettiest of constructions, & it still needs some work (hen I get somemore ammo for my glue gun!) but I think its clear where I'm heading for.
As a side note, by chance I pre-ordered some "Nordic Villagers" from the Dwarf Wars range at salute. Combined with my few Mordheim "angry mob" models, they should make for a decent crowd of spectators. They also fit the style of my Norse Blood Bowl team so all I have to do now is convert a suitably Norse Pit fighter I guess..... Ho hum... another project for the never ending list!

Heres what I did today: another little Necromunda piece- a wrecked power generator (actually the engine from a large Airfix Bently model) ...I've added some tubing to it, drilled in some bullet holes, and glued it to the base, but there is still a little to do before painting- some more debris- broken gears, mesh, girders etc, and some more bulking out with plasticine (I love it ) to sink it into the ground...
